> > I am kernel newbie, I want to know the importance of kobject, can anybody
> > explain the importance of kobject with an example.
>
> To state a not-so-popular analogy, kobjects can also be viewed as root
> object in object oriented programming. So a bit like java.lang.Object.
> Of course it is not a root object and indeed C is not OO, but this
> view helps in thinking about it.
Well, it _is_ a "root object", and you can write OO code in C, which is
what we did for kobjects (and struct device, and struct class, and kref,
and other things like that.)
So it is a "popular" analogy, as this is exactly what the authors of the
code were intending for people to see.
